Cocalia
Cocalia is a genus of flowering plants in the family Asteraceae, commonly known as the daisy family. The genus was first described in 1919. Plants in the genus Cocalia are typically herbaceous perennials native to East Asia, with a distribution that includes China, Japan, and Korea. They are found in a variety of habitats, including woodlands, meadows, and along stream banks.
